Page d'accueil » comment » Pourquoi mes fichiers MP3 ont-ils la même taille même lorsque je modifie le débit avec FFmpeg?

    Pourquoi mes fichiers MP3 ont-ils la même taille même lorsque je modifie le débit avec FFmpeg?

    Si vous débutez dans le processus de conversion de fichiers audio, de nombreux détails et leur fonctionnement peuvent être un peu déroutants lorsque vous obtenez des résultats inattendus. Alors, que faites-vous pour résoudre le problème? Aujourd'hui, le message Q & R de SuperUser répond à la question d'un lecteur confus.

    La séance de questions et réponses d'aujourd'hui nous est offerte par SuperUser, une sous-division de Stack Exchange, un groupe de sites Web de questions-réponses dirigé par la communauté..

    Photo gracieuseté de Warein (Flickr).

    La question

    Lecteur superutilisateur Arlen Beiler veut savoir pourquoi l’utilisation de différents paramètres de débit lors de la conversion d’un flux audio produit des fichiers de la même taille:

    J'ai converti un flux audio en trois paramètres de débit différents en utilisant essentiellement le même format. Ils ont fini par avoir exactement la même taille. Pourquoi est-ce?

    • ffmpeg -i “Likoonl-Q1-All.mp4” -c: v copie -c: un libmp3lame -q: un 1-b: un 192k “Q1-All-192k.mp4”
    • ffmpeg -i “Likoonl-Q1-All.mp4” -c: v copie -c: un libmp3lame -q: un 1 -b: un 160k “Q1-All-160k.mp4”
    • ffmpeg -i “Likoonl-Q1-All.mp4” -c: v copie -c: un libmp3lame -q: un 1-b: un 128k “Q1-All-128k.mp4”

    Comment l'utilisation de différents paramètres de débit a-t-elle produit des fichiers de la même taille??

    La réponse

    Slhck, contributeur de SuperUser, a la solution pour nous:

    Parce que vous vous mettez -q: a (qui est le réglage VBR de LAME). Quand vous utilisez -q: a, le réglage CBR -b: a n'aura aucun effet. Si vous consultez le guide d’encodage MP3 du Wiki FFmpeg, vous trouverez les valeurs possibles pour -q: a avec leur débit moyen correspondant.

    Par souci d’exhaustivité, voici la partie pertinente de libmp3lame.c (qscale est le long nom de q):


    Avez-vous quelque chose à ajouter à l'explication? Sound off dans les commentaires. Voulez-vous lire plus de réponses d'autres utilisateurs de Stack Exchange doués en technologie? Découvrez le fil de discussion complet ici.